Influence of Budget Availability, Value Engineering (VE), Life Cycle Cost Analysis (LCCA), and Green Building Understanding on Green Building Implementation in School Buildings in DKI Jakarta

Abstract

The application of the green building concept in school buildings in DKI Jakarta is one of the strategic steps in supporting sustainable development. The concept aims to improve energy efficiency, reduce environmental impact, and create a healthy learning environment. However, the level of implementation still faces various challenges influenced by a number of factors. This study aims to analyze the influence of budget availability, Value Engineering (VE), Life Cycle Cost Analysis (LCCA), and understanding of green building concepts on the level of application of green building concepts in school buildings in DKI Jakarta. This study uses a quantitative approach with a survey method. Data was obtained through questionnaires distributed to related parties, such as school managers, consultants, and contractors involved in the construction and renovation of school buildings. Data analysis was carried out using multiple regression techniques to test the influence of each independent variable on the dependent variable. The results of the study show that the availability of budget, VE, LCCA, and understanding of green building concepts significantly affect the level of application of green building concepts in school buildings. Budget availability is a major factor influencing implementation decisions, while VE and LCCA contribute to efficient and sustainable decision-making. On the other hand, the level of understanding of the concept of green building also plays an important role in determining the extent to which this concept can be applied optimally. This research provides recommendations to local governments, school managers, and related parties to increase budget allocation.
